I too am a fan of horror games 

 

The absolute most terrifying one I ever played was Eternal Darkness: Sanity's Requiem. It played with my mind so bad I started believing...time to turn the lights back on!

 

Since then I played and finished Haunting Ground (like you), though I was more annoyed by the end of the villain's interruptions to chase you than anything else. Still enjoyed it.  I imagine you might not have had access to Rule of Rose (banned in Australia, maybe in Europe too). It too featured a canine companion but I actually felt more connected with him than Hewie (though Hewie definitely got the better name lol). That one horrified as opposed to terrorising. Kuon was also from that era and really did well with sudden frights. The limited respawns increased the difficulty and made you even more cautious. 

 

Until Dawn is really good too. Getting everyone to survive is difficult.  It excelled in suspense and atmosphere. 

 

I have many more but those stick out the best. Especially Eternal Darkness...

System Shock 2 and Fatal Frame 2 were both games the got under my skin. I never finished Silent Hill 2 but that game was all kinds of creepy. The S.T.A.L.K.E.R. games are creepy too, though they're more like FPS games with horror elements mixed in, the dark and eerie atmosphere in S.T.A.L.K.E.R. is incredibly hard to beat and some of the monsters in it just made me feel intimidated and uncomfortable, as good horror should.

Also surprised no one has mentioned Amnesia: The Dark Descent because it almost seems like an obligatory game to mention when it comes to horror.
